A modelling buddy found this photo some years back.

Some discussion by others much more learned than I on these things,  as to whether it was an Artillery FO charger or, given the stuff on the engine deck an ARV of some sort.
I like the ARV plan

Over the past 18 months a reasonable facsimile of this has started to evolve out of a pretty ordinary Dragon Stug


Well after a burst of wild enthusiasm, we have burst into frenzied activity and ended  up here


Still some more weatheration to do and fix the figures up a bit.
The skirts are way too short, as they were based on a Pz III set template and Stug skirts are evidently deeper.
